Responsibilities

  • Provision of Strategic Advisory Support: Assists the Director-General in the overall direction and management of the United Nations Office at Nairobi (UNON), and in coordinating functions within the Office of the Director-General.
  •  Management of the Office of the Director-General: Manages the operations of the Office of the Director-General by supervising outputs and organizing workflow and communications.
  • Reviews, prepares, and clears correspondence, official statements, and reports.
  • Manages the team of Special Assistant and other office staff as determined by the Director-General.
  • Liaison with Member States and Stakeholders: Maintains liaison with heads of missions and other high-ranking representatives of Member States, organizations, donors, and partners in the region on protocol and procedural matters.
  • Performs protocol and liaison functions with the host country authorities.
  • Represents the Director-General, as required, at UN meetings, during high-level official visits, and at conferences held in Nairobi.
  • Internal UN coordination: Assists the Director-General in coordinating among UNON’s divisions and ensuring that decisions from the Senior Management Team meetings are implemented and followed up.
  • Supports the Director-General in coordinating with other UN entities based in Nairobi, including close cooperation with UN Secretariat entities—particularly Senior Leadership at UNEP and UN-Habitat—as well as at the inter-agency level with the Senior Management of the Agencies, Funds, and Programmes present in the country.
  • Represents and assists the Director-General, as required, in coordinating with UN Secretariat headquarters departments and offices across the UN Secretariat.
  • Coordinates monitoring, evaluation, reporting, and oversight functions for the United Nations Office at Nairobi.
  • Leads team members efforts to collect and analyze data and provide insight to identify trends or patterns for data-driven planning, decision-making, presentation and reporting. Ensure that all stakeholders can discover, access, integrate and utilize the data they need as appropriate.
  • Other duties: Undertakes other assignments as requested by the Director-General.

Education

  • Advanced university degree (Master's degree or equivalent) in public administration, management, social sciences, international relations or a related area is required.
  • A first-level university degree in combination with two additional years of qualifying experience may be accepted in lieu of the advanced university degree.
  • Successful completion of both degree and non-degree programs in data analytics, business analytics or data science programs is desirable.

Work Experience

  • A minimum of fifteen (15) years of experience in public administration and management in a large international organization such as the UN at the international level is required. A minimum of ten (10) years of experience in advising senior leadership on complex cooperation and coordination of inter-agency issues is required.
  • A minimum of ten (10) years of experience in negotiations with senior-level officials at the intergovernmental level is required.
  • A minimum of five (5) years of experience supervising complex and multifunctional teams is required. A proven track record of at least five (5) years in the coordination of service delivery at the inter-agency level is required.
  • A proven track record of at least ten (10) years in supporting senior staff in the implementation of complex plans of work/compacts is desirable. Experience in data analytics or related area is desirable.
